Abstract

Single crystals of α−(BEDT−TTF) 2BrI 2 were prepared using standard electrochemical techniques in nitrogen saturated benzonitrile solution containing (n-C 4H 10) 4NBrI 2 as supporting electrolyte. The crystal is found to be triclinic, space group p1̄. The most prominent intermolecular S-S contacts (the shortest one being 3.468Å) are found between the stacks of BEDT-TTF. The room temperature conductivities in ab-plane range typically between2–10 (ohm, cm) -1. The conductivity anisotropy in this plane is small with ratio of σ a σ b ≦ 2 , while in the direction perpendicular to the ab-plane show a conductivity value at least 1000 times smaller. The temperature dependence of conductivities shows that in the temperature range between265 (245) K and 300K the crystal behaves like a two-dimensional metallic conductor and a metal-insulator transition occurs at 265 (245) K.
